Abrodictyum obscurum

by | Oct 26, 2020 | Ferns | 0 comments

Collection data (H.T. Brent, )

Collection Data
  • Collection Date: 15-X-2020
  • Primary collector: H.T. Brent
  • Habitat: Tropical rainforest
  • Habit: Terrestrial
  • Observations: Fronds thin, with projections on underside, growing in a clump from a central point. Mostly found on road cut bank (possibly detection bias). Fronds up to ca. 12 cm.
Abrodictyum obscurum
Collection Location
  • Country: Australia
  • State or Province: Queensland
  • Coordinates: -17.115332,145.603206
  • Elevation: 780 m
